Key Responsibilities:

  • Provide direct nursing care under RN/physician direction, including medication administration, wound care, IV therapy, and vital sign monitoring.
  • Conduct focused patient assessments (physical exams, medical history, medication review) and contribute to individualized care plans.
  • Administer medications and treatments accurately, following protocols and documenting outcomes.
  • Perform wound assessment, cleaning, dressing changes, and monitor for signs of infection or complications.
  • Insert, maintain, and monitor IV lines and urinary catheters; collect specimens (blood, urine, sputum) for laboratory testing.
  • Maintain accurate, timely patient records documenting condition changes, interventions, and medication administration.
  • Educate patients and families on diagnoses, medications, self-care, and preventive health measures.
  • Assist with patient comfort, mobility, positioning, and basic pain management.
  • Respond to emergencies, providing basic life support and following established protocols.
  • Follow infection control practices and proper PPE use; handle, store, and dispose of medications and supplies safely.
  • Advocate for patient rights and coordinate care with RNs, physicians, therapists, and support staff.
  • Supervise CNAs or unlicensed assistive personnel when required and perform other duties assigned by management.
  • Participate in ongoing education to stay current with nursing standards and best practices.
